Jake Shields is a Free Man (free to sign with the UFC)
(The middle finger means 'thanks for the memories')
Loretta Hunt of Sherdog reports that Strikeforce has released Jake Shields.
Others would describe it as a firing and it was even rumored that Strikeforce tried, and failed, to keep Shields out of the HP Pavillion last Saturday night.
The second Shields appeared in a loving embrace with Dana White in the Arco Arena the gig was up and the irony is it might actually hurt Jake's negotiating power with Zuffa. Now Shields has no choice but to sign with the promotion as Strikeforce has effectively washed their hands of him.
